Agency Work

Preferred terminology used by CIETT and by certain European social partners to describe temporary staffing provided through a staffing company. Hence “Agency Work Business” (AWB) and Agency Worker. The term “Agency Worker” is a U.K. legal term used to refer to an individual who is engaged by an Employment Business (see definition) to perform labor for one or more of the Employ-ment Business’ clients. There is a contractual relationship between the Agency Worker and the Employ¬ment Business and the Agency Worker is paid by the Employment Business. There is no contractual relationship between the Agency Worker and the end user client. Direction and control of the Agency Worker is exclusively the responsibility of the user client. Mainly used in Western Europe.

Source: Staffing Industry Analysts
